Eyebrow Waxing

Precise eyebrow shaping technique
Eyebrow waxing is a meticulous hair removal method that shapes and defines brows for a well-groomed, symmetrical appearance. The process involves applying warm wax to unwanted hair, which is then quickly removed, followed by the application of a soothing gel.

This technique offers long-lasting results, typically requiring maintenance every 3 to 4 weeks. While there may be brief discomfort during hair removal, the process is generally quick and efficient. Proper preparation and aftercare, including avoiding products and sun exposure around the treatment area, ensure optimal results.

For a more comprehensive treatment, eyebrow waxing can be combined with tinting. This adds depth and intensity to the brows, enhancing the shape created by waxing and reducing the need for daily makeup application.

Frequently Asked Questions

No questions left unanswered.

Hot waxing is a gentler hair removal method that is particularly effective for sensitive areas such as the bikini line, underarms, and face. During the treatment, hot wax is applied to the skin, allowing it to shrink-wrap around the hairs without sticking to the skin. Once cooled, the wax is removed, pulling the hairs from the root. This method leaves the skin smooth and hair-free for up to six weeks.

Hot waxing is much less painful than traditional waxing methods. The wax only adheres to the hair, not the skin, which reduces discomfort. Any pain felt during the treatment is brief and minimal, and there is no lingering stinging sensation afterward.

Hot waxing can keep you hair-free for up to six weeks, depending on your hair growth cycle. Regular treatments may extend the time between sessions as hair regrows finer and slower over time.

Hot waxing is ideal for sensitive areas like the bikini line, underarms, and face. However, it can be used on most parts of the body, including legs, arms, and back, for smooth, long-lasting results.

To prepare for waxing, stop shaving or using hair removal creams at least two weeks before your appointment. Exfoliate your skin to remove dead cells and free any trapped hairs. Avoid applying moisturiser on the day of your appointment, as it can affect the wax's effectiveness.

After waxing, your skin may appear slightly red or have a "plucked chicken" look, which is normal. Minor bleeding may occur if the hairs are thick, but this should subside within 24 hours. Applying a soothing gel will help reduce any redness and swelling.

You can schedule hot waxing sessions as frequently as every three weeks, thanks to its ability to remove very short hairs (as short as 1mm). Regular appointments ensure you maintain consistently smooth skin.

After waxing, avoid exposing the waxed area to heat, such as sunbathing, hot baths, or saunas, for 24 hours. Refrain from using perfumed products and, if you’ve waxed your underarms, avoid deodorants for 24 hours to allow the skin to heal properly.

Hot waxing minimises the risk of ingrown hairs because it removes the hair directly from the root. However, some people may still be prone to them, particularly in the bikini area. Regular exfoliation helps prevent and manage ingrown hairs as the hair regrows.

It’s best to schedule your waxing appointment 2-3 days before your holiday. This allows time for any redness or sensitivity to subside. If you're planning a spray tan, wait 24 hours after waxing to ensure the wax doesn't interfere with the tanning process.
